About Texas A&M International University

Founded in 1970, Texas A&M International University has grown into one of the leading public universities in South Texas, welcoming students from more than 30 countries.

The university offers undergraduate, master's, doctoral, and certificate programs through several academic colleges, including:

·        A.R. Sanchez, Jr. School of Business

·        College of Arts & Sciences

·        College of Education

·        College of Nursing & Health Sciences

·        Graduate School

Tuition Fees at Texas A&M International University (TAMIU)

Texas A&M International University (TAMIU) is one of the most affordable public universities in the Texas A&M University System. It offers quality education, modern research facilities, and career-oriented programs at competitive tuition rates for international students.

Estimated Annual Tuition Fees

Program

Estimated Tuition (USD)

Bachelor's Degree

$20,000 – $24,000

Master's Degree

$16,000 – $22,000

MBA

$17,000 – $23,000

Doctoral Programs

Varies by program

Note: Tuition fees vary depending on the academic program, credit hours, and university policies. Students should always verify the latest tuition details before applying.

Cost of Living in Laredo, Texas

Laredo is one of the more affordable cities in Texas for international students.

Estimated Monthly Living Expenses

Expense

Estimated Cost (USD)

Accommodation

$650 – $1,100

Food

$250 – $450

Transportation

$80 – $180

Health Insurance

$120 – $250

Personal Expenses

$150 – $350

Estimated Monthly Budget

Approximately $1,250–$2,330 per month

Students living with roommates can significantly reduce their monthly expenses.

English Language Requirements

International applicants whose previous education was not completed in English must demonstrate English language proficiency.

Accepted tests include:

·        IELTS Academic

·        TOEFL iBT

·        Duolingo English Test

·        Pearson PTE Academic

Typical minimum accepted scores include:

·        IELTS: 5.5

·        TOEFL iBT: 69

·        Duolingo English Test: 100

·        PTE Academic: 47

Form I-20 Process

After admission and verification of financial documents, Texas A&M International University issues the Form I-20 to eligible international students.

The Form I-20 is required to:

·        Pay the SEVIS I-901 Fee

·        Apply for the U.S. F1 Student Visa

·        Schedule the visa interview

·        Enter the United States as an F1 student

Students requesting an I-20 must submit financial documents demonstrating sufficient funds for tuition and living expenses.

SEVIS Fee & F1 Visa Process

After receiving your Form I-20:

1.      Pay the SEVIS I-901 Fee.

2.      Complete the DS-160 application form.

3.      Schedule your F1 visa appointment.

4.      Attend biometrics (if applicable).

5.      Attend the F1 visa interview.

6.      Receive your passport with the F1 visa if approved.

Ensure all information matches across your passport, DS-160, and Form I-20.

CPT & OPT Opportunities

Curricular Practical Training (CPT)

Eligible F-1 students may participate in Curricular Practical Training (CPT) after receiving university authorization. CPT must be directly related to the student's academic program and approved before employment begins.

Optional Practical Training (OPT)

Eligible graduates may apply for Optional Practical Training (OPT) to gain practical work experience related to their field of study.

Students graduating from eligible STEM programs may also qualify for the 24-month STEM OPT Extension, allowing up to 36 months of work authorization under current U.S. immigration regulations.
